Cómo agregar una barra de desplazamiento horizontal a un div Cómo agregar un marco de barra de desplazamiento horizontal a un div
Cómo agregar una barra de desplazamiento a un div 1. (Establece el alto y el ancho según sea necesario)
Nota: Si solo escribes el alto, solo tendrás un desplazamiento vertical bar, si solo escribes el ancho, solo tendrás una barra de desplazamiento horizontal, por lo que no escribir nada no tiene ningún efecto. También aquí, el desbordamiento está configurado en automático, lo que significa que si la altura de su página es superior a 300 píxeles, habrá barras de desplazamiento; si tiene menos de 300 píxeles, no habrá barras de desplazamiento. Del mismo modo, si el ancho es mayor que 100 px, aparece la barra de desplazamiento; si el ancho es menor que 100 px, no hay barra de desplazamiento.
2. También puedes configurar el desplazamiento desbordado, es decir:
No importa si la altura de tu página es mayor o menor que 300 px, aparecerá la barra de desplazamiento y el ancho será. lo mismo.
3. También puedes configurarlo así.
Barra de desplazamiento horizontal:
Barra de desplazamiento vertical:
Horizontal más vertical:
Datos extendidos
p >/p>pConfigurar la visualización de la barra de desplazamiento:
overflow:yespConfigurar la visualización adaptativa de la barra de desplazamiento:
overflow:autopConfigurar la visualización de la barra de desplazamiento superior e inferior:
overflow-y:yesp Configure las barras de desplazamiento superior e inferior para mostrar de forma adaptativa:
overflow-y:auto Si p está incluido en otros objetos como td, la posición se puede establecer en relativa:
position:relative
¿Cómo desplazar la barra de desplazamiento DIV a una posición específica a través de JQuery?
$("#p_id").animate({scrollTop:100},300); El código anterior se puede implementar. scrollTop representa la distancia para desplazarse hacia abajo y 300 representa el tiempo de animación de desplazamiento en milisegundos.
p>
¿Tutorial de diseño Div+Css?
Lo he escrito antes, así que aquí está el código más corto. El efecto lo he probado personalmente. Es compatible con navegadores modernos como IE7/8 y Chrome. >
!doctypehtml>
html>
head>
metacharset="utf-8">
title>p +css diseño/título superior, medio e inferior >>p>
estilo>
html,body{height:100%;*overflow:hidden;/*Eliminar la barra de desplazamiento horizontal en IE7 */}
cuerpo{margin:0;padding:0;font-size:30px;text-align:center;color:#fff;}
.top,.nav ,.foot{ancho:100%;alto :100px;posición:absoluta;}
.top{fondo:rojo;top:0;}
.nav{fondo:azul ;arriba:100px;abajo:100px;alto :auto;}
.foot{fondo:gray;abajo:0;}
/estilo>
/cabeza>
cuerpo>
p>Yo soy la cabeza/p>
p>Esto ha sido adaptado al fondo/p>
p>Soy el de abajo/p >
/body>
/html>
Nota: IE6 no lo admite. Si desea una solución perfecta, utilice js para obtener dinámicamente la altura de la página y luego asígnela para navegar en esa capa.
¿Cómo deshabilitar el desplazamiento y la edición de la página después de que aparece un DIV en JS?
Establezca la capa emergente en position:absolute;z-index:101 y luego use una capa p2, width:100%,height:100%.z-index:100,position:absolute; de modo que p2 cubra toda la página y no se pueda hacer clic en ningún elemento de la página (el índice z predeterminado de los elementos de la página es 0. Si hay un índice z alto, el índice z de p2 debe ser establecido en un nivel superior). Para deshabilitar el desplazamiento, puede agregarlo al desbordamiento del cuerpo: oculto no mostrará la barra de desplazamiento y no podrá desplazarse